§ 106‑579.9. Prohibited acts.

It shall be unlawful to:

(1)        Distribute any antifreeze which is adulterated ormisbranded.

(2)        Distribute any antifreeze which has been banned by theBoard.

(3)        Distribute any antifreeze which has not been registered inaccordance with G.S. 106‑579.4 or whose labeling is different from thataccepted for registration; provided, that any antifreeze declared to bediscontinued by the registrant must be registered by the registrant for onefull year after distribution is discontinued; provided further, that anyantifreeze in channels of distribution after the aforesaid registration periodmay be confiscated and disposed of by the Commissioner, unless the antifreezeis acceptable for registration and is continued to be registered by themanufacturer or the person offering the antifreeze for wholesale or retailsale.

(4)        Refuse to permit entry or inspection or to permit theacquisition of a sample of antifreeze as authorized by G.S. 106‑579.8.

(5)        Dispose of any antifreeze that is under "stopsale" or "withdrawal from distribution" order in accordance withG.S. 106‑579.10.

(6)        Distribute any antifreeze unless it is in the registrant'sor manufacturer's unbroken package or is installed by the seller into thecooling system of the purchaser's vehicle directly from the registrant's ormanufacturer's package, and the label on such package if less than fivegallons, or the labeling of such package if five gallons or more, does not bearthe information required by G.S. 106‑579.6(1), (2), (3), and (4).

(7)        Use the term "ethylene glycol" in connection withthe name of a product which contains other glycols unless it is qualified bythe word "base," "type," or similar word, and unless theproduct meets the following requirements:

a.         It consists essentially of ethylene glycol;

b.         If it contains suitable glycols other than ethylene glycol,that no more than a maximum of fifteen percent (15%) of such other glycols bepresent;

c.         It contains a minimum total glycol content of ninety‑threepercent (93%) by weight;

d.         The specific gravity is corrected to give reliable freezing‑pointreadings on a commercial ethylene glycol type hydrometer; and

e.         The freezing point of a fifty percent (50%) by volumeaqueous mixture of the antifreeze shall not be above ‑34º F.

(8)        Refuse, when requested, to permit a purchaser to see thecontainer from which antifreeze is drawn for installation into the purchaser'svehicle.

(9)        Refill any container bearing a registered label, unless bythe registrant or his duly designated jobber, under regulations established bythe Board.

(10)      Distribute any antifreeze for which a practical, rapid meansfor measuring the freeze protection by the user is not readily available,whether by hydrometer or other means.

(11)      Distribute antifreeze which is in violation of the FederalPoison Prevention Packaging Act and regulations and related federal and Stateproduct safety laws and regulations.

(12)      Distribute antifreeze in home consumer‑sized packageswhich are constructed of either transparent or translucent packaging materials.

(13)      Disseminate any false or misleading advertisement relating toan antifreeze product. (1975, c. 719, s. 9.)
